Circuit/System Description
WARNING: This page is about a different car, the 2008 Suzuki Swift +, 2008 Pontiac Wave, and 2008 Chevrolet Aveo. However, it is still accessible from the selected car via links, so may be relevant.
The engine control module (ECM) uses information from the crankshaft position (CKP) sensor to determine when an engine misfire is occurring. By monitoring variations in the crankshaft rotation speed for each cylinder, the ECM is able to detect individual misfire events. The camshaft position (CMP) sensor is used to identify which cylinder is misfiring if a majority of the misfire occurs on the same cylinder. If there is a camshaft position (CMP) sensor error, misfire will be detected but the specific cylinder cannot be identified.